The lessons are student centered. You will learn in a variety of ways. There will be tasks, independent study, group discussions, presentations, evaluation of your work etc. Your progress will be reviewed by your tutor. You will be learning English but at the same time you will be improving your IT skills. By the end of the course you will be able to: - start, maintain and close simple face to face conversations on topics that are familiar, or of personal interest - paraphrase short written passages, orally in a simple fashion - ask someone to clarify or elaborate what they have just said - write simple texts about experiences or events - reply in written form to advertisements and ask for more complete information about products Your teacher will mark your work and make comments on the work you have done. Your teacher will talk to you about your learning goals and will set targets for you to achieve throughout the duration of the course. Your teacher will monitor your progress and discuss methods for achieving your targets. You will also sit an end of term assessment
